Individualized Career Services. Individualized Career Services are documented primarily by entering the appropriate activity code in CalJOBS. CONTRACTOR shall enter Program activities, case notes, file documentation, goals, and fiscal tracking of training expenditures into CalJOBS within fourteen (14) calendar days of the activity occurring. CONTRACTOR shall use the correct State-designated activity codes for each Program activity, ensuring that similar activities for different programs are entered correctly. CONTRACTOR shall submit a monthly report of activities and activity codes entered into CalJOBS to MIS Unit by the fifteenth (15th) working day of the following month. CONTRACTOR will ensure that CONTRACTOR’s staff has used the correct activity codes by monitoring activity code data entry on a regular basis. CONTRACTOR shall not submit more than five (5) requests to MIS staff during the term of this AGREEMENT for State changes to activity codes entered incorrectly. CONTRACTOR will document Individualized Career Services as follows: a. Intake, initial assessment, development of IEP (Subsection E (2)(a) Items i-iii above) will be documented by entering correct activity code(s) into CalJOBS and an initial case note entered no later than three business days after service has been provided. One case note may be used to document items i-iii if they occurred on the same date.
